Australia’s summer, spanning December through February, unfolds as a radiant period embraced by sun-soaked days and many outdoor adventures. It’s a time to revel in the charm of diverse landscapes, from the Red Centre’s fiery allure to the coastal marvels and vibrant festivities peppering the land.

Tasmania’s Trail Treasures

Venturing to Tasmania promises an idyllic summer retreat. This haven beckons with a mild climate, perfect for hiking the Three Capes Track or strolling along the Bay of Fires’ pristine beaches. Immerse yourself in the lush lavender fields, relishing their beauty and the irresistible lavender-infused treats. Tassie also thrives with summer festivals like the Taste of Tasmania and the thrilling Rolex Sydney to Hobart Yacht Race, amplifying the region’s allure.

The Great Barrier Reef’s Secrets

The Great Barrier Reef, a colossal aquatic wonder, invites exploration despite its summer quirks. While northern areas may face humidity and occasional tropical storms, the Southern Great Barrier Reef offers a reprieve. Witness the breathtaking coral spawning phenomenon while safeguarding yourself with the jetpilot life vest and embracing the turtle nesting season on islands like Lady Elliot or Heron Island, where nature’s spectacle unfolds in all its glory.

Luxuriate in the Red Centre

Journeying into the heart of Australia’s outback, the Red Centre, evokes a sense of awe and wonder. Summer here demands preparation for scorching temperatures, yet it’s an opportunity to experience luxury amidst the wilderness. Delight in a stay at the opulent Longitude 131 lodge, paired with helicopter tours over Uluru and Kata Tjuta, culminating in sunset dinners against the backdrop of these iconic monoliths.

South Australia’s Coastal Charms

South Australia epitomises summer bliss with its azure waters and seafood delights. Dive into the sea’s embrace, swimming alongside dolphins or exploring Coffin Bay’s oyster havens. Kangaroo Island unfolds as a paradise for wildlife enthusiasts, offering encounters with diverse fauna alongside indulgent tastings of local wine, gin, cheese and honey.

Melbourne’s Diverse Delights

Summer in Melbourne is synonymous with vibrant events, notably the Australian Open, a thrilling convergence of sports and entertainment. Escape the urban hustle to explore the Great Ocean Road, relish wine on the Mornington Peninsula, or trek the stunning trails of Wilsons Promontory. Encounter cuddly koalas and charming penguins on Phillip Island, culminating in the mesmerising penguin parade at dusk.

Sydney’s Coastal Splendour

Sydney’s summer beckons with its picturesque coastlines and family-friendly beaches. Embrace the surf culture at Bondi Beach, embark on guided hikes to nature’s wonders, or simply unwind at rooftop bars. The dazzling New Year’s Eve fireworks over Sydney Harbour, alongside the famed yacht race, make for unforgettable experiences. Explore charming coastal towns or retreat to the serenity of the Blue Mountains for a cooler reprieve.

Western Australia’s Wonders

Western Australia, anchored by Perth’s stunning beaches, offers a myriad of adventures. Swim with dolphins in Rockingham or snorkel with sea lions at Jurien Bay. Rottnest Island enchants with its tranquil vibe and endearing quokkas. Explore Margaret River’s fusion of breathtaking beaches and renowned wineries, or revel in the coastal splendour of Esperance and Cape Le Grand National Park.

The Bottom Line

Australia’s summer radiates with myriad experiences, with each corner promising an adventure waiting to be discovered. Embrace the warmth, the landscapes and the diverse cultural tapestry that define this vibrant season down under.
